What is a contract process engineer?

Contract Process Engineers are professionals who are hired on a temporary or project-specific basis to design, optimize, and troubleshoot industrial processes within a company. They often work in industries such as chemicals, pharmaceuticals, oil and gas, or manufacturing, providing technical expertise to improve production efficiency, safety, and quality. Their responsibilities may include process design, equipment specification, project management, and ensuring regulatory compliance. Because they work on a contract basis, their assignments may vary in length and scope depending on the needs of the employer.

What types of projects or industries do contract process engineers typically work on, and how does this influence their daily responsibilities?

Contract Process Engineers often work on short- to medium-term assignments across industries such as pharmaceuticals, chemicals, oil and gas, and manufacturing. The nature of their projects can range from process optimization and troubleshooting to equipment commissioning and plant upgrades. Depending on the industry and project scope, daily responsibilities may include conducting process simulations, collaborating with multidisciplinary teams, preparing technical documentation, and ensuring compliance with safety and quality standards. This variety allows for broad experience, but also requires adaptability and strong communication skills to integrate quickly with new teams and workflows.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ract process eng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Contract Process Engineer, you need a solid background in chemical or process engineering, experience with process optimization, and a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with process simulation software (like Aspen HYSYS or CHEMCAD), project management tools, and safety compliance standards is typically expected. Strong analytical thinking, effective communication, and adaptability are valuable soft skills for managing changing project requirements and collaborating with diverse teams. These skills ensure efficient, safe, and cost-effective process improvements that meet contractual obligations and client expectations.

What is the difference between Contract Process Engineer vs Process Engineer?

AspectContract Process EngineerProcess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, relevant certifications (e.g., Six Sigma)Bachelor's or higher in Engineering, similar certifications
Work EnvironmentContract-based, project-specific, often in industrial or manufacturing settingsFull-time, ongoing roles in manufacturing, chemical, or industrial plants
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by companies hiring temporary or project-based engineersEmployed by companies for continuous process improvement and operations
Search & Comparison IntentCommonly compared for project-based roles and contract workCompared for permanent roles in process optimization

The Contract Process Engineer typically works on temporary, project-specific assignments, focusing on process improvements within a set timeframe. In contrast, the Process Engineer holds a permanent position, overseeing ongoing operations and continuous process optimization. Both roles require similar qualifications but differ mainly in employment type and work scope.

About Walbec Group

Walbec Group is a leading provider of high-quality construction materials and professional design, engineering, and construction services. Our family of companies, Payne & Dolan, Northeast Asphalt, Zenith Tech, Parisi Construction, Premier Concrete, and Construction Resources Management, delivers innovative solutions across the Midwest.

From bridge construction and shoreline stabilization to solar site development and infrastructure rehabilitation, Walbec is built on expertise, safety, and a strong ethical foundation. Our teams take pride in delivering exceptional results on every project.

Position Summary

Reporting to Corporate Counsel, the Contract Analyst plays a key role in reviewing, drafting, and negotiating a wide range of contracts across Walbec's operating companies. This position supports business partners by balancing legal risk with practical, business-focused solutions in a fast-paced, high-volume environment.

Key Responsibilities

  • Review, analyze, and negotiate a high volume of contracts, including subcontracts, service and supply agreements, access and material agreements, and equipment rental agreements
  • Conduct pre-bid and contract risk reviews
  • Draft and revise agreements using standardized templates
  • Partner with internal stakeholders to ensure contracts align with operational needs
  • Conduct legal and regulatory research to support contract interpretation and risk mitigation
  • Assist in maintaining and improving contract templates and processes

Qualifications

  • Paralegal degree or certificate, or equivalent relevant experience, required
  • 3-5 years of relevant experience in contract review and drafting
  • Valid driver's license and satisfactory driving record

Preferred Skills & Attributes

  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Sound judgment and practical negotiation skills
  • Ability to manage competing priorities and meet deadlines
  • Strong attention to detail and organizational skills
  • Ability to work effectively in a high-volume, deadline-driven environment
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office and DocuSign
  • Familiarity with AI-powered contract lifecycle management tools is a plus
